We invest in educating our community because informed investors make better decisions and achieve superior results. Bridger Aerospace Group Holdings Inc. (BAER) recently released its first quarter 2026 financial results, revealing continued challenges for the aerial firefighting and wildfire management company. The company reported a net loss of $0.69 per share, representing a deeper decline compared to the year-ago period. Management Commentary

The management team's discussion centered on the inherent seasonality of the wildfire suppression business and the company's operational readiness. Leadership emphasized that Q1 traditionally represents a slower period for firefighting activity, as favorable weather conditions across most major fire-prone regions reduce demand for aerial support services. This seasonal trough impacts revenue generation and contributes to the quarterly loss. Company executives highlighted investments in fleet maintenance and crew training during the off-season, positioning the assets for optimal deployment when wildfire risk elevates. The discussion touched on customer relationships and contract negotiations for the upcoming fire season, with management expressing cautious optimism regarding demand levels. Bridger Aero's management team noted that ongoing discussions with government agencies and forestry services remain active, though specific contract details were not disclosed. The leadership acknowledged the challenging financial performance while framing the results within the context of the company's long-term strategic objectives. Management emphasized that investments made during the first quarter are designed to enhance service capabilities and operational efficiency when demand increases during the warmer months. The commentary reflected awareness of shareholder concerns regarding the persistent losses while maintaining focus on the seasonal business model. Forward Guidance

Bridger Aero did not issue specific numerical guidance for the remainder of 2026, aligning with industry practice of avoiding detailed forecasts in the volatile wildfire management sector. However, company leadership provided qualitative commentary regarding expectations for the upcoming fire season. Management indicated that early indicators suggest normal to above-normal wildfire activity potential across several key operating regions, which could translate to increased demand for the company's Twin Otter and Citation aircraft fleet. The company maintained its strategic focus on expanding customer relationships with federal, state, and international wildfire management agencies. Leadership discussed efforts to diversify revenue streams through enhanced services and potential new market opportunities. Bridger Aero's forward-looking statements emphasized operational readiness, fleet availability, and crew preparedness as key priorities heading into the seasonal ramp-up period. Investor communications suggested the company remains focused on prudent capital management while positioning for potential demand increases. Management acknowledged the importance of controlling costs during the low-activity quarters while maintaining the capability to scale operations rapidly when conditions warrant. The company did not announce specific financial targets or revenue projections for Q1 2026 or beyond. Market Reaction

Market participants reacted cautiously to the Q1 2026 earnings, with trading activity reflecting uncertainty regarding the company's path to improved financial performance. The negative EPS result aligned with seasonal expectations for the firefighting sector, yet investors continue to seek clarity on revenue trajectory and operational leverage potential. Trading volume remained moderate as the market processed the limited disclosure. Analysts covering BAER noted the challenges inherent to the seasonal business model while monitoring early-season demand signals. Industry observers suggest that weather patterns and fire activity levels in the coming months will be critical determinants of Bridger Aero's financial performance in 2026. The company's ability to convert its operational investments into revenue during peak season will likely influence sentiment toward the shares. The broader wildfire management sector continues to attract attention due to persistent fire activity trends in North America and internationally. Market participants appear to be adopting a wait-and-see approach, with emphasis on summer performance as the primary catalyst for potential positive momentum in BAER shares.
